It’s Official: Vampire Race Set Record

In preparation for its annual Harvest Run last October, the Loveland Road Runners Club in Colorado decided to attempt a new world record for the largest gathering of people dressed as vampires. Since there was no previous record, it was merely a matter of defining the rules, following all the proper procedures, and filling out the paperwork. And now, four months later, it’s official. Guinness World Records recognizes the 354 people who participated as the largest gathering of vampires ever.

Dressing as a vampire is a little but more involved than dressing as a gorilla, Santa or a sumo wrestler. To be counted as vampires, “Women wore black and red dresses, black heels, fangs, dark eye makeup and red lipstick, while the men showed up in capes, fangs, black pants, white shirts, vests, neckties or frills.”
